Defining the Essentials of Katana vs Wakizashi
The katana vs wakizashi represents more than just a simple size distinction—it embodies different philosophical approaches to blade design and combat application. A samurai's katana typically measures between 24 to 28 inches in blade length, making it the primary weapon in a samurai's arsenal, while a wakizashi generally ranges from 12 to 24 inches, serving as a secondary weapon. Many people ask how katana differs from wakizashi, and the answer involves numerous elements. While blade length represents the most obvious distinction, the deeper differences involve traditional role. How long is a wakizashi compared to katana? A typical katana measures 24-28 inches, while a typical wakizashi ranges from between 12 and 24 inches. Beyond these dimensions, what is wakizashi used for versus katana? The secondary blade performed various functions, including intimate fighting situations, domestic security, and symbolic functions within warrior culture.
How do you identify authenticity in samurai blades? Authentic katana and wakizashi demonstrate particular features including correct bend, recognizable metallurgical marks, and appropriate weight distribution.
